We present V, I photometry of the Sagittarius Dwarf Spheroidal galaxy (Sgr)
for a region of ~ 1^{circ} times 1^{circ}, centered on the globular cluster M
54. This catalog is the largest database of stars (~500,000) ever obtained for
this galaxy. The wide area covered allows us to measure for the first time the
position of the RGB-bump, a feature that has been identified in most Galactic
globular clusters and only recently in a few galaxies of the Local Group. The
presence of a single-peaked bump in the RGB differential Luminosity Function
confirms that there is a dominant population in Sgr (Pop A).
The photometric properties of the Pop A RGB and the position of the RGB bump
have been used to constrain the range of possible ages and metallicities of
this population. The most likely solution lies in the range -0.6 < [M/H] <=
-0.4 and 4 Gyr <= age <= 8 Gyr.Comment: 14 pages, 4 figures, accepted by ApJ Letter
